Abstract
714,526. Arc-rupturing in switches; switch contacts. SWITCHGEAR & COWANS, Ltd., and ROWLAND, F. G. Feb. 11, 1953 [Feb. 25, 1952], No. 4861/52. Class 38(5) An air-break switch has a deep arc chute 4 which completely envelops the fixed and moving contacts 5, 11, a hoop 19 of magnetic material around the chute above the level of the contacts, and separate fixed magnetic members 20 inside the chute and above the level of the hoop. When the arc 21 is drawn, it bows up into the space enclosed by the hoops and the flux set up by the arc links with the hoop 19. With light current arcs, Fig. 6, the flux inside the arc loops is strengthened to move the arc rapidly into contact with the magnetic members 20. The flux in linking with the hoop 19 and with the members 20 as the arc rises in the chute, brings the arc into close contact with a side of the chute, the ends of the chute and the members 20 to ensure maximum cooling and deionizing of the arc. Under high current arc conditions, the ends of.the hoop 19 saturate and some of the flux returns over the arc, Fig. 14, to prevent the arc rising too rapidly. The members 20 may be plates of magnetic material extending across the chute transversely to the arc. Alternatively the members 20 may be magnetic plates split longitudinally and provided with insulating centre portions or air gaps. In a modification, Fig. 16 (not shown), spaced plates of insulating material are provided and strips of magnetic material are inserted between them on both sides of the chute. The hoop 19 may be provided with an air gap at each end, and may be extended so as to link with a blow-out coil, Fig. 15 (not shown). Switch contacts: The moving contact assembly comprises pivoted arms 10 carrying a pivoted contact 11 which is biased by compression springs 13, 14. A stop 15 limits the movement of the contact 11 relative to the arms 10.
